Kalina T. Haas is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biophysics and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Kalina T. Haas has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 535 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Biophysics and 5 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Kalina T. Haas’s work include Advanced Fluorescence Microscopy Techniques (7 papers), Polysaccharides and Plant Cell Walls (5 papers) and Plant Reproductive Biology (4 papers). Kalina T. Haas is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Fluorescence Microscopy Techniques (7 papers), Polysaccharides and Plant Cell Walls (5 papers) and Plant Reproductive Biology (4 papers). Kalina T. Haas collaborates with scholars based in France, Belgium and United Kingdom. Kalina T. Haas's co-authors include Alexis Peaucelle, Raymond Wightman, Elliot M. Meyerowitz, Herman Höfte, Eric Hosy, Olivier Thoumine, Mathieu Letellier, Terrence J. Sejnowski, Daniel Choquet and Matthieu Sainlos and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Nucleic Acids Research and Nature Communications.
